Train Derailment in Cimmaron County

Joe Denoyer - August 14, 2022 1:09 pm

Crews are working to remove 12 train cars that derailed in Cimarron County, Oklahoma.

According to the Cimarron County Sheriff’s Office, a BNSF train hauling coal derailed around 6:55 p.m. Friday near Boise City.

CCSO said no injuries were reported.

NS27/EW20 and Hwy325(EW19)/ W Main were initially blocked.

According to CCSO, Hwy 325 reopened around 13:30 a.m. Saturday after the the train was separated.

“Removal crews are on scene at NS27/EW20,” said CCSO. “Removal and reconstruction of the railway will be significant. Please continue to avoid the area.”
